Captain Forster Hammock Preserve

We went on a 4th of July mid-morning. There was only one other person on the trail with their dog so it ended up being a nice quiet walk on lovely shaded trails which was nice since it was already hot. We encountered a large gopher turtle and lots of pretty butterflies. We went across A1A to the beach which was a nice end to the trail. We opted to stay on the main trails as noted by others as the smaller trails aren’t well-kept and a bit muddy. It was nice that there is plenty of parking, water fountains to refill water and restrooms. They even offer dog bags to pick up after your pets (please do this to keep the trail nice for everyone!) All in all, def a great trail to bring your pup on!

Nice brew house to bring your dog

Pareidolia Brewing Co.

We were staying at Island View Cottages which was a nice walk to Riverview Park and then we headed over to brewery which was just a short walk from the park. the outdoor area was nice to sit outside (even on a hot day) and enjoy a couple of bites and brews with our dog. Only critique is that we had to go inside to order and dogs aren’t allowed inside - fortunately i wasn’t alone but would be difficult if you went alone.
